The Castillo de Sabiote is a historically significant fortress located in the charming municipality of Sabiote, within the province of Jaén, Andalusia, Spain. Perched at an elevation of 794 metres on high ground, this impressive castle offers commanding views of the surrounding Guadalimar Valley, the distant Sierra Morena, and the majestic Sierra Mágina mountains. It stands as a prime example of 16th-century military architecture, uniquely blending Gothic and Renaissance styles.

Visitors are consistently captivated by the castle's rich history and architectural grandeur. Its strategic position, recognized since ancient times, provides unparalleled panoramic vistas, making it one of the best viewpoints in the Sabiote area. The blend of robust defensive features with elegant Renaissance details, such as the Plateresque frontispiece and heraldic shields, truly sets the Castillo de Sabiote apart as a must-see historical site.

Stepping inside the Castillo de Sabiote, you can almost feel the centuries of history. The grand hall, divided by brick arches and covered with barrel vaults, offers a glimpse into its past as a Renaissance palace-residence. The sheer scale of the ashlar masonry walls and the intricate design of the defensive towers evoke a strong sense of its former military importance and the vision of figures like Don Francisco de los Cobos.

    Fortification built in the 13th century, although due to the defensive pre-eminence that the hill occupies in the entire region of La Loma, it must have been a place encased by all civilizations since time immemorial.
